Dear Residents,

It is that time of year again when we will all be receiving the 2nd installment of our 2025 property tax bills.

I know property taxes are an important concern for many of our residents, and I encourage homeowners to take a few minutes to review their bill carefully.

The Second Installment reflects the remaining portion of your 2025 property tax bill, including any applicable exemptions. Your bill also provides a detailed breakdown of the taxing districts that receive a portion of your property taxes, giving you a better understanding of where your tax dollars go. For a quick and convenient overview, we’ve included a simple graph below illustrating how property tax dollars are distributed among the various taxing bodies.  Note that the Village of South Barrington asks for only 5.93% of your total tax bill to provide the services you receive.

 

Residents can visit the Cook County Treasurer’s Office for helpful information about their property tax bill, payment options, exemptions and refunds. You can also view your bill online, review your property tax history and access other resources using your property address or 14-digit Property Index Number (PIN). Hard copies of your property tax bills will be mailed to you within the next 2 weeks.

SUPPORTING STUDENT WELLNESS

This week, I had the pleasure of joining the Barrington Youth & Family Services, the Barrington Area Community Foundation of which I am a board member, and Barrington High School at their recent ribbon cutting to celebrate new enhancements to student spaces.

These thoughtful additions, including comfortable furniture, a moss mural, acoustic panels, and local photography, help create welcoming spaces that support student well-being, morale, and a positive school environment.

It was wonderful to see our community come together and support the important work these great organizations do for our community. A special thank you to BACF and BYFS for helping make this possible!

WELCOME: OFFICER MASCIOPINTO

We have a new addition to our police department. This week, I welcomed Officer Richard Masciopinto, our newest member of the South Barrington Police Department, at a swearing in ceremony.

A former U.S. Marine, Officer Masciopinto brings a strong foundation of discipline, teamwork, leadership, and commitment to service as he begins his career in law enforcement. He joined our team this week and is headed straight to the academy for his training.

While you won’t see him out in the community just yet, we are excited to welcome him to South Barrington and look forward to all he will accomplish. Thank Officer Masciopinto for stepping up to serve our community!

Welcome to the team, Officer Masciopinto!

WORKING TOGETHER TO IMPROVE RECYCLING

Recycling has always been an important part of South Barrington’s commitment to protecting our environment and being responsible stewards of our community, both today and for future generations.

As a SWANCC partner, we are excited to participate in a new recycling education and testing program running September 14 through October 5. During this time, we will work alongside SWANCC representatives to help educate our community about proper recycling practices and the important role each of us plays in keeping recyclable materials out of the wrong waste streams.

This program will provide valuable tools and data to help us better understand our recycling habits and identify ways we can all improve. How we recycle affects everyone, including the efficiency and cost of the recycling services provided to our community. Improperly disposed items can cause contamination, equipment breakdowns and damage to recycling machinery, which can ultimately lead to increased costs.

Our goal is simple: reduce improper recycling, improve the quality of what we place in our recycling bins and work together to make a positive environmental impact.

Stay tuned for more information about this program and how you can participate. Together, we can continue building a cleaner, more sustainable South Barrington for generations to come!

SAVE THE DATE: 2ND ANNUAL PUMPKIN SMASH

Last year, we held our first Pumpkin Smash and by popular demand…it is back!

Join us on Nov. 7th at the South Barrington Conservancy from 9:30am-12pm for a fun morning of pumpkin smashing!

The Pumpkin Smash started with a simple idea and a great partnership with SCARCE, an organization dedicated to environmental education and sustainability. What began as a way to keep pumpkins out of the landfill has grown into a fun, family-friendly community event that gives pumpkins a second life through composting.

If you joined us last year, you know what a fun morning it was! If you missed it, this is your year to join us for a family-friendly event that kids and adults alike will enjoy.

As you collect your pumpkins this fall, remember to save them for smashing!
